首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Php SQLITE中的分页

在PHP中,SQLite是一种轻量级的嵌入式数据库引擎,它提供了一个简单的、零配置的数据库解决方案。分页是一种常见的数据展示方式,它将大量的数据分割成多个页面进行展示,以提高用户体验和数据加载速度。

在PHP SQLite中实现分页可以通过以下步骤:

  1. 查询总记录数:首先,需要执行一条SQL查询语句来获取总记录数,可以使用COUNT函数来统计记录数。
  2. 计算总页数:根据总记录数和每页显示的记录数,可以计算出总页数,公式为:总页数 = ceil(总记录数 / 每页记录数)。
  3. 设置当前页码:根据用户请求的页码,可以确定当前页码。
  4. 构建分页查询语句:使用LIMIT关键字来限制查询结果的范围,可以通过计算得到偏移量和每页记录数来构建分页查询语句,例如:SELECT * FROM 表名 LIMIT 偏移量, 每页记录数。
  5. 执行分页查询:使用SQLite的API或者PDO扩展等方式执行构建好的分页查询语句,获取当前页的数据。
  6. 显示分页导航:根据总页数和当前页码,可以生成分页导航,提供用户切换页面的功能。

在腾讯云的产品中,可以使用云数据库SQL Server版(https://cloud.tencent.com/product/cdb_sqlserver)来代替SQLite,它提供了更强大的数据库功能和性能,并且支持分布式部署和高可用性。

总结起来,PHP SQLite中的分页是通过查询总记录数、计算总页数、设置当前页码、构建分页查询语句、执行分页查询和显示分页导航等步骤来实现的。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券